1. 什么是比特币钱包密钥碰撞?
比特币是一种加密数字货币,使用公钥密码学体系来确保安全交易。比特币钱包密钥碰撞指的是两个不同的私钥产生相同的公钥,从而导致两个钱包地址相同的情况。这种碰撞是极其罕见的,但一旦发生,可能会引发交易的混淆和安全问题。
2. 如何处理比特币钱包密钥碰撞?
如果发现比特币钱包密钥碰撞,以下是一些处理方法:
1. 停止使用碰撞的地址:确保不再使用碰撞地址进行任何交易或转账。
2. 密钥前缀更改:生成新的私钥,通过对前缀进行修改,确保与碰撞的私钥不同。
3. 导入备份:如果你已经创建了比特币钱包的备份,在导入备份时,存在性能好的钱包会自动检测到碰撞并为您找到新的唯一地址。
4. 寻求专业帮助:如果你不确定如何处理密钥碰撞问题,建议寻求专业比特币安全团队的帮助。
3. 比特币钱包密钥碰撞的影响
比特币钱包密钥碰撞可能引发以下
1. 资金的混淆:如果两个不同用户的私钥碰撞并对应同一公钥和地址,他们的资金可能会混在一起,导致交易的不确定性。
2. 安全性:密钥碰撞可能被黑客利用,试图进行不法的交易或窃取资金。
4. 如何预防比特币钱包密钥碰撞?
虽然比特币密钥碰撞非常罕见,但可以采取以下措施预防:
1. 使用高质量的随机数生成器:选择可靠的钱包应用程序或硬件钱包,确保生成的私钥是真正随机的。
2. 备份钱包:定期备份你的钱包,以防止任何不可预见的问题发生。
3. 多重签名:使用多重签名功能增加比特币钱包的安全性,确保需要多个密钥才能进行交易。
4. 定期更新钱包软件:钱包软件的开发者会修复漏洞和安全问题,定期更新可以提高安全性。
5. 密钥碰撞的历史案例
尽管比特币钱包密钥碰撞的概率极低,但确实发生过一些历史案例:
1. 2013年,开发者Casascius Coin发现了比特币钱包密钥碰撞的问题,他们停止了使用被碰撞的密钥。
2. 2014年,开发者Petr Gandalovič在随机生成过程中发现了一个私钥碰撞,他采取了充分的预防措施,以确保不会再发生类似事件。
3. 迄今为止,密钥碰撞问题在比特币网络中还没有造成大规模的恶意行为,但在使用比特币时仍需保持警惕。
以上是关于比特币钱包密钥碰撞的问题及解决方法的详细介绍。如有更多疑问,请随时咨询比特币安全专家或相关机构。